Al-Qadsiah vs Al-Fayha Prediction: 7/11/2024

Al-Qadsiah will face Al-Fayha at home in Thursday’s Professional League matchup. Predictions, statistics, and the latest odds for this game are all available here.

Al-Qadsiah heads into this match on a positive note after a 2-0 league win over Al-Ettifaq. In that game, they controlled 56% of possession with 9 shots on goal, two of which found the net, courtesy of Gastón Álvarez and Julián Quiñones. Across their last six games, Al-Qadsiah has scored a total of seven goals, averaging 1.17 per match.

Meanwhile, Al-Fayha comes off a 1-1 draw with Al-Fateh in their previous league outing. Al-Fayha held 56% possession and had seven shots, three of which were on target, while Lucas Zelarayán scored for Al-Fateh. In their last six games, Al-Fayha has scored six goals, averaging one goal per game.

Al-Qadsiah will be missing Ibrahim Mohannashi due to a cruciate ligament injury, while Al-Fayha’s only absence is Henry Onyekuru, sidelined with an injury.

 

Prediction

Al-Qadsiah is expected to have multiple chances on goal and capitalize effectively, while Al-Fayha may struggle to find the back of the net despite posing occasional threats. A 3-1 win in favor of Al-Qadsiah seems likely.

Experts are predicting over 1.5 goals in this game.
